We review the advantages and drawbacks of the main optical modulation formats, comparing the standard intensity-modulated ones to more sophisticated phase and intensity modulated formats for high capacity or long distance transmission. Furthermore, different Forward Error Correction solutions, from standard Reed Solomon (RS) to block turbo codes, are presented and their impact on optical transmission system design is discussed. © 2003 Académie des sciences/Éditions scientifiques et médicales Elsevier SAS.
